Hoorsenbuhs, which obtained its namesake from a Dutch trade ship of founder Robert Keith’s ancestors that ferried precious metals and gems around the world, is slowly gaining momentum among tastemakers.

The Santa Monica-based luxury jewelry label grew more organically than strategically.  Instead of creating a collection that was then distributed to retailers, Robert would develop a new piece and someone in his intimate circle of friends (musicians, visual artists, photographers, actors) “would inevitably ask to use it in a project.  And the line just grew from there.”
